Macro gộp dữ liệu nhiều sheets excel vào 1 sheet

Cách gộp nhiều sheet thành 1 sheet trong Excel

Trong Lúc sử dụng ứng dụng Excel để biên soạn thảo hoặc thống kê lại tài liệu, chắc rằng những các bạn sẽ đương đầu cùng với câu hỏi sử dụng các sheet nhằm lưu trữ dữ liệu sau đó lại mong mỏi đề xuất gộp tài liệu trên nhiều sheet vào và một sheet nhằm tổng đúng theo. Trong nội dung bài viết này, ThuThuatPhanMem.vn đang hướng dẫn chúng ta giải pháp gộp những sheet thành một nhanh chóng.

Bạn đang xem: Macro gộp dữ liệu nhiều sheets excel vào 1 sheet

*

Bình hay nghĩ về tới vấn đề gộp những sheet thành một trong các Excel, có lẽ sẽ sở hữu được một số bạn nghĩ cho tới bí quyết làm thủ công bằng tay sẽ là copy tài liệu từ bỏ sheet này để paste sang trọng sheet khác. Dù thế, là 1 người tiêu dùng Excel tuyệt vời thì chúng ta cũng có thể áp dụng mẹo nhỏ để gộp các sheet chứ đọng không nhất thiết phải xào nấu và dán dữ liệu thủ công.

Dựa theo một ví dụ sau đây, chúng ta gồm nhì sheet tài liệu nhỏng hình dưới, ThuThuatPhanMem.vn đang triển khai các bước gộp tài liệu bên trên nhì sheet đầu kia vào sheet Tổng hợp ở cuối.

*

Để hoàn toàn có thể gộp sheet vào cùng nhau, các bạn áp dụng Microsoft Visual Basic của Excel.

Các bạn sử dụng tổ hợp phím Alt F11 để bật Microsoft Visual Basic lên, tiếp kia các bạn cliông chồng vào tab Insert trên tkhô hanh cách thức của Visual Basic rồi chọn dòng Module.

*

Tiếp đó các bạn dán đoạn code tiếp sau đây vào size biên soạn thảo của Microsoft Visual Basic:

Sub MergeSheets() Const NHR = 1 Dlặng MWS As Worksheet Dyên ổn AWS As Worksheet Dim FAR As Long Dyên LR As Long Set AWS = ActiveSheet For Each MWS In ActiveWindow.SelectedSheets If Not MWS Is AWS Then FAR = AWS.UsedRange.Cells(AWS.UsedRange.Cells.Count).Row + 1 LR = MWS.UsedRange.Cells(MWS.UsedRange.Cells.Count).Row MWS.Range(MWS.Rows(NHR + 1), MWS.Rows(LR)).Copy AWS.Rows(FAR) End If Next MWS End Sub

*

Sau kia các bạn click vào trang Excel bao gồm, các bạn mở sheet bạn thích tổng thích hợp các sheet khác vào. Sau kia các bạn bnóng duy trì phím Ctrl rồi lựa chọn hầu như sheet ao ước tổng vừa lòng.

Xem thêm: Hàm Đọc Số Tiền Bằng Chữ Trong Excel 2010, Hướng Dẫn Cách Đọc Số Tiền Bằng Chữ Mới Nhất 2020

Sau đó các bạn cliông chồng mở ribbon View bên trên thanh khô cơ chế.

*

Chọn Marcos với lựa chọn chiếc View Macros.

*

Khi bảng Macro xuất hiện, những bạn có thể thấy vào danh sách chạy Macro bao gồm mẫu MergeSheets. Các các bạn chọn dòng này rồi cliông xã vào Run nhằm chạy lệnh.

*

Bởi vậy sheet tổng phù hợp của các bạn sẽ được gộp được tài liệu của không ít sheet sẽ lựa chọn.

*

Bài viết lý giải vấn đề gộp các sheet thành một sheet của ThuThuatPhanMem.vn công ty chúng tôi cho tới đấy là dứt. Hi vọng rằng thông qua bài viết này, các bạn vẫn thế được cách thức gộp các sheet vào một trong những sheet. Hẹn chạm mặt lại các bạn giữa những bài viết không giống trên trang.

destination source:http://thuthuatphanmem.vn/cach-gop-nhieu-sheet-thanh-1-sheet-trong-excel/